Class TerminationTreeItemContentViewImpl
- java.lang.Object
-
- org.optaplanner.workbench.screens.solver.client.editor.TerminationTreeItemContentViewImpl
-
- All Implemented Interfaces:
org.jboss.errai.common.client.api.IsElement,TerminationTreeItemContentView
@Dependent @Templated public class TerminationTreeItemContentViewImpl extends Object implements TerminationTreeItemContentView
-
-
Constructor Summary
Constructors Constructor Description TerminationTreeItemContentViewImpl(org.gwtbootstrap3.client.ui.Button removeTerminationButton, org.gwtbootstrap3.client.ui.DropDownMenu dropdownMenuList, org.jboss.errai.ui.client.local.spi.TranslationService translationService)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ddDropDownOption(org.optaplanner.workbench.screens.solver.model.TerminationConfigOption terminationConfigOption)org.jboss.errai.common.client.dom.HTMLElementgetElement()voidhandleBestScoreFeasibleIn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leBestScoreIn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leDaysS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leHoursS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leMilliS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leMinutesS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leTerminationCompositionStyleSelectCh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leUnimprovedDaysS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leUnimprovedHoursS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leUnimprovedMilliS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leUnimprovedMinutesS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handleUnimprovedS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idhideBestScoreFeasibleInput()voidhideBestScoreLimitInput()voidhideScoreCalculationCountLimitInput()voidhideStepCountLimitInput()voidhideTimeSpentInput()voidhideUnimprovedStepCountLimitInput()voidhideUnimprovedTimeSpentInput()voidonScoreCalculationLimitIn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idonStepCountLimitIn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idonUnimprovedStepCountLimitInputChange(com.google.gwt.event.dom.client.ChangeEvent event)voidremoveDropDownOption(org.optaplanner.workbench.screens.solver.model.TerminationConfigOption option)voidsetBestScoreFeasible(Boolean value)voidsetBestScoreLimit(String value)voidsetDaysSpent(Long value)voidsetDropDownHelpContent(String content)voidsetFormLabelHelpContent(String content)voidsetFormLabelText(String text)voidsetHoursSpent(Long value)voidsetMillisecondsSpent(Long value)voidsetMinutesSpent(Long value)voidsetNestedTreeItem(boolean nested)voidsetPresenter(TerminationTreeItemContent presenter)voidsetRoot(boolean root)voidsetScoreCalculationCountLimit(Long value)voidsetSecondsSpent(Long value)voidsetStepCountLimit(Integer value)voidsetTerminationCompositionStyle(org.optaplanner.workbench.screens.solver.model.TerminationCompositionStyleModel value)voidsetUnimprovedDaysSpent(Long value)voidsetUnimprovedHoursSpent(Long value)voidsetUnimprovedMillisecondsSpent(Long value)voidsetUnimprovedMinutesSpent(Long value)voidsetUnimprovedSecondsSpent(Long value)voidsetUnimprovedStepCountLimit(Integer value)
-
-
-
Method Detail
-
handleDaysSpentInputChange
@EventHandler("daysSpentInput") public void handleDaysS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leHoursSpentInputChange
@EventHandler("hoursSpentInput") public void handleHoursS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leMinutesSpentInputChange
@EventHandler("minutesSpentInput") public void handleMinutesS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leSecondsSpentInputChange
@EventHandler("secondsSpentInput") public void handleS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leMilliSecondsSpentInputChange
@EventHandler("millisecondsSpentInput") public void handleMilliS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leUnimprovedDaysSpentInputChange
@EventHandler("unimprovedDaysSpentInput") public void handleUnimprovedDaysS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leUnimprovedHoursSpentInputChange
@EventHandler("unimprovedHoursSpentInput") public void handleUnimprovedHoursS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leUnimprovedMinutesSpentInputChange
@EventHandler("unimprovedMinutesSpentInput") public void handleUnimprovedMinutesS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leUnimprovedSecondsSpentInputChange
@EventHandler("unimprovedSecondsSpentInput") public void handleUnimprovedS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leUnimprovedMilliSecondsSpentInputChange
@EventHandler("unimprovedMillisecondsSpentInput") public void handleUnimprovedMilliSecondsSpentIn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
onStepCountLimitInputChange
@EventHandler("stepCountLimitInput") public void onStepCountLimitIn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
onUnimprovedStepCountLimitInputChange
@EventHandler("unimprovedStepCountLimitInput") public void onUnimprovedStepCountLimitIn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
onScoreCalculationLimitInputChange
@EventHandler("scoreCalculationCountLimitInput") public void onScoreCalculationLimitIn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leBestScoreInputChange
@EventHandler("bestScoreInput") public void handleBestScoreIn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leBestScoreFeasibleInputChange
@EventHandler("bestScoreFeasibleInput") public void handleBestScoreFeasibleInputCh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
handleTerminationCompositionStyleSelectChange
@EventHandler("terminationCompositionStyleSelect") public void handleTerminationCompositionStyleSelectChange(com.google.gwt.event.dom.client.ChangeEvent event)
-
setPresenter
public void setPresenter(TerminationTreeItemContent presenter)
- Specified by:
setPresenterin interfaceTerminationTreeItemContentView
-
setRoot
public void setRoot(boolean root)
- Specified by:
setRootin interfaceTerminationTreeItemContentView
-
addDropDownOption
public void addDropDownOption(org.optaplanner.workbench.screens.solver.model.TerminationConfigOption terminationConfigOption)
- Specified by:
addDropDownOptionin interfaceTerminationTreeItemContentView
-
removeDropDownOption
public void removeDropDownOption(org.optaplanner.workbench.screens.solver.model.TerminationConfigOption option)
- Specified by:
removeDropDownOptionin interfaceTerminationTreeItemContentView
-
setNestedTreeItem
public void setNestedTreeItem(boolean nested)
- Specified by:
setNestedTreeItemin interfaceTerminationTreeItemContentView
-
hideTimeSpentInput
public void hideTimeSpentInput()
- Specified by:
hideTimeSpentInputin interfaceTerminationTreeItemContentView
-
hideUnimprovedTimeSpentInput
public void hideUnimprovedTimeSpentInput()
- Specified by:
hideUnimprovedTimeSpentInputin interfaceTerminationTreeItemContentView
-
hideStepCountLimitInput
public void hideStepCountLimitInput()
- Specified by:
hideStepCountLimitInputin interfaceTerminationTreeItemContentView
-
hideUnimprovedStepCountLimitInput
public void hideUnimprovedStepCountLimitInput()
- Specified by:
hideUnimprovedStepCountLimitInputin interfaceTerminationTreeItemContentView
-
hideScoreCalculationCountLimitInput
public void hideScoreCalculationCountLimitInput()
- Specified by:
hideScoreCalculationCountLimitInputin interfaceTerminationTreeItemContentView
-
hideBestScoreFeasibleInput
public void hideBestScoreFeasibleInput()
- Specified by:
hideBestScoreFeasibleInputin interfaceTerminationTreeItemContentView
-
hideBestScoreLimitInput
public void hideBestScoreLimitInput()
- Specified by:
hideBestScoreLimitInputin interfaceTerminationTreeItemContentView
-
setFormLabelText
public void setFormLabelText(String text)
- Specified by:
setFormLabelTextin interfaceTerminationTreeItemContentView
-
setFormLabelHelpContent
public void setFormLabelHelpContent(String content)
- Specified by:
setFormLabelHelpContentin interfaceTerminationTreeItemContentView
-
setDropDownHelpContent
public void setDropDownHelpContent(String content)
- Specified by:
setDropDownHelpContentin interfaceTerminationTreeItemContentView
-
setDaysSpent
public void setDaysSpent(Long value)
- Specified by:
setDaysSpentin interfaceTerminationTreeItemContentView
-
setHoursSpent
public void setHoursSpent(Long value)
- Specified by:
setHoursSpentin interfaceTerminationTreeItemContentView
-
setMinutesSpent
public void setMinutesSpent(Long value)
- Specified by:
setMinutesSpentin interfaceTerminationTreeItemContentView
-
setSecondsSpent
public void setSecondsSpent(Long value)
- Specified by:
setSecondsSpentin interfaceTerminationTreeItemContentView
-
setMillisecondsSpent
public void setMillisecondsSpent(Long value)
- Specified by:
setMillisecondsSpentin interfaceTerminationTreeItemContentView
-
setUnimprovedDaysSpent
public void setUnimprovedDaysSpent(Long value)
- Specified by:
setUnimprovedDaysSpentin interfaceTerminationTreeItemContentView
-
setUnimprovedHoursSpent
public void setUnimprovedHoursSpent(Long value)
- Specified by:
setUnimprovedHoursSpentin interfaceTerminationTreeItemContentView
-
setUnimprovedMinutesSpent
public void setUnimprovedMinutesSpent(Long value)
- Specified by:
setUnimprovedMinutesSpentin interfaceTerminationTreeItemContentView
-
setUnimprovedSecondsSpent
public void setUnimprovedSecondsSpent(Long value)
- Specified by:
setUnimprovedSecondsSpentin interfaceTerminationTreeItemContentView
-
setUnimprovedMillisecondsSpent
public void setUnimprovedMillisecondsSpent(Long value)
- Specified by:
setUnimprovedMillisecondsSpentin interfaceTerminationTreeItemContentView
-
setStepCountLimit
public void setStepCountLimit(Integer value)
- Specified by:
setStepCountLimitin interfaceTerminationTreeItemContentView
-
setUnimprovedStepCountLimit
public void setUnimprovedStepCountLimit(Integer value)
- Specified by:
setUnimprovedStepCountLimitin interfaceTerminationTreeItemContentView
-
setScoreCalculationCountLimit
public void setScoreCalculationCountLimit(Long value)
- Specified by:
setScoreCalculationCountLimitin interfaceTerminationTreeItemContentView
-
setBestScoreFeasible
public void setBestScoreFeasible(Boolean value)
- Specified by:
setBestScoreFeasiblein interfaceTerminationTreeItemContentView
-
setBestScoreLimit
public void setBestScoreLimit(String value)
- Specified by:
setBestScoreLimitin interfaceTerminationTreeItemContentView
-
setTerminationCompositionStyle
public void setTerminationCompositionStyle(org.optaplanner.workbench.screens.solver.model.TerminationCompositionStyleModel value)
- Specified by:
setTerminationCompositionStylein interfaceTerminationTreeItemContentView
-
getElement
public org.jboss.errai.common.client.dom.HTMLElement getElement()
- Specified by:
getElementin interfaceorg.jboss.errai.common.client.api.IsElement
-
-